About Columbia Global Financial Statements

Columbia Global investors use historical fundamental indicators, such as Columbia Global's revenue or net income, to determine how well the company is positioned to perform in the future. Understanding over-time patterns can help investors decide on long-term investments in Columbia Global. Please read more on our technical analysis and fundamental analysis pages.
The fund invests at least 80 percent of its net assets in equity securities of technology companies that may benefit from technological improvements, advancements or developments. It invests at least 25 percent of the value of its total net assets at the time of purchase in the securities of issuers conducting their principal business activities in the technology and related group of industries.
